Packages that use org.eclipse.core.runtime
org.eclipse.ant.core Provides support for running the Ant build tool in the platform. 
org.eclipse.compare Provides support for performing structural and textual compare operations on arbitrary data and displaying the results. 
org.eclipse.compare.contentmergeviewer Support for compare and merge viewers which show the content side-by-side. 
org.eclipse.compare.patch Provides support for applying and working with patches. 
org.eclipse.compare.rangedifferencer Provides support for finding the differences between two or three sequences of comparable entities. 
org.eclipse.compare.structuremergeviewer Provides support for finding and displaying the differences between hierarchically structured data. 
org.eclipse.core.commands.operations Classes for the creation of undoable operations which can be added to an operations history and later be undone and redone. 
org.eclipse.core.databinding Provides classes for binding observable objects, for example UI widgets and model objects. 
org.eclipse.core.databinding.util Provides general utilities for data binding. 
org.eclipse.core.databinding.validation Provides the core APIs for validation. 
org.eclipse.core.expressions Application programming interfaces for the expression language. 
org.eclipse.core.filebuffers Provides the API for accessing file buffers. 
org.eclipse.core.filebuffers.manipulation Provides the API for manipulating file buffers. 
org.eclipse.core.filesystem Provides an interface for interacting with a file system. 
org.eclipse.core.filesystem.provider Provides an API to be extended by a file system implementation. 
org.eclipse.core.internal.jobs   
org.eclipse.core.internal.resources   
org.eclipse.core.net.proxy Provides support for the management of platform level proxy settings. 
org.eclipse.core.resources Provides basic support for managing a workspace and its resources. 
org.eclipse.core.resources.mapping Provides APIs for integrating application models with the workspace Package Specification This package specifies the APIs in the Resources plug-in that are used to integrate application models with the workspace. 
org.eclipse.core.resources.team Provides APIs intended to be implemented by the Team component. 
org.eclipse.core.runtime Provides support for the runtime platform, core utility methods and the extension registry. 
org.eclipse.core.runtime.content Provides core support for content types. 
org.eclipse.core.runtime.dynamichelpers Provides helpers to facilitate the authoring of dynamic plug-ins. 
org.eclipse.core.runtime.jobs Provides core support for scheduling and interacting with background activity. 
org.eclipse.core.runtime.model Provides core support for the modeling plug-ins and the plug-in registry.

IPluginDescriptor
          Deprecated.  IPluginDescriptor was refactored in Eclipse 3.0. Most of the functionality has moved to Platform and the plug-in descriptor has been replaced with the OSGi Bundle object.

This interface must only be used by plug-ins which explicitly require the org.eclipse.core.runtime.compatibility plug-in.

For most uses the bundle object can be treated as an opaque token representing your plug-in to the system -- It must be supplied to various Platform methods but need not be interrogated itself. There are a small number of plug-in descriptor method equivalents supplied by Bundle itself. The details are spelled out in the comments on each IPluginDescriptor method.

Clients of this interface have a reference to an IPluginDescriptor corresponding to a plug-in. To adapt to the deprecation, the bundle corresponding to the plug-in generally needs to be acquired. There are several cases:

  • the descriptor was discovered using methods such as IPluginRegistry.getPluginDescriptor(). The code should be updated to use one of the bundle discovery mechanisms such as Platform.getBundle().
  • the descriptor is from the plug-in itself. The code should be updated to use the plug-in's bundle instead.
  • the descriptor is supplied by a third party. The plug-in writer must cooperate with that party to obtain a bundle rather than a descriptor.

The resulting bundle object can be used to carry out the adaptation steps outlined for each of the IPluginDescriptor methods.

ILibrary
          Deprecated. In Eclipse 3.0 the plug-in classpath representation was changed. Clients of ILibrary are directed to the headers associated with the relevant bundle. In particular, the Bundle-Classpath header contains all available information about the classpath of a plug-in. Having retrieved the header, the ManifestElement helper class can be used to parse the value and discover the individual class path entries. The various header attributes are defined in Constants .

For example,

     String header = bundle.getHeaders().get(Constants.BUNDLE_CLASSPATH);
     ManifestElement[] elements = ManifestElement.parseHeader(
         Constants.BUNDLE_CLASSPATH, header);
     if (elements == null) 
         return;
     elements[0].getValue();   // the jar/dir containing the code
     ...
 

Note that this new structure does not include information on which packages are exported or present in the listed classpath entries. This information is no longer relevant.

See IPluginDescriptor for information on the relationship between plug-in descriptors and bundles.

This interface must only be used by plug-ins which explicitly require the org.eclipse.core.runtime.compatibility plug-in.

IPluginPrerequisite
          Deprecated. In Eclipse 3.0 the plug-in prerequisite representation was changed. Clients of IPluginPrerequisite are directed to the headers associated with the relevant bundle. In particular, the Require-Bundle header contains all available information about the prerequisites of a plug-in. Having retrieved the header, the ManifestElement helper class can be used to parse the value and discover the individual prerequisite plug-ins. The various header attributes are defined in Constants .

For example,

    String header = bundle.getHeaders().get(Constants.REQUIRE_BUNDLE);
     ManifestElement[] elements = ManifestElement.parseHeader(
         Constants.REQUIRE_BUNDLE, header);
     if (elements == null) 
         return;
     elements[0].getValue();   // the prerequisite plug-in id
     elements[0].getAttribute(Constants.BUNDLE_VERSION_ATTRIBUTE);   // the prerequisite plug-in version
     ...
 

See IPluginDescriptor for information on the relationship between plug-in descriptors and bundles.

This interface must only be used by plug-ins which explicitly require the org.eclipse.core.runtime.compatibility plug-in.

IPluginRegistry
          Deprecated. The plug-in registry has been generalized in Eclipse 3.0. It is now the IExtensionRegistry. Most of the IPluginRegistry function is directly supported on the new interface without change. Most clients of IPluginRegistry need only to change their references to use IExtensionRegistry. The only exceptions are methods that return IPluginDescriptors. See the relevant method comments for details.

This interface must only be used by plug-ins which explicitly require the org.eclipse.core.runtime.compatibility plug-in.
